Q. Who is Cosmo Genovese?
A. Cosmo Genovese has the coolest name in Hollywood. If you pay attention to the end credits (back when TV shows still had end credits and not just a blur of letters in the lower quarter of the screen while news and ads filled the rest of the screen), you might notice that Cosmo Genovese was a script supervisor for The A-Team.
He also did supervision for Perry Mason in the sixties, Rat Patrol, and Tales from the Crypt: Demon Knight, as well as Star Trek: The Next Generation, where his utterly awesome name garnered some attention.
